Understanding Ceramides and Why Lowering Them Matters
Ceramides are lipid molecules that exist in every cell of the body. In healthy amounts, they help regulate structure and communication.
But when levels rise, ceramides may interfere with fat-burning pathways, increase inflammation, and reduce mitochondrial efficiency — all of which create a sense of metabolic “heaviness.”
Research highlighted by NCBI suggests that ceramides contribute to disruptions in lipid metabolism and energy production.
Lowering ceramides naturally can help improve:
- energy stability
- appetite signals
- fat oxidation
- inflammatory balance
- metabolic resilience

Lifestyle Strategies to Support Lower Ceramide Levels
Lifestyle often plays a larger role in ceramide elevation than people realize. Small, consistent habits — not extreme protocols — create the strongest foundation.
Improve Sleep Quality
According to National Library of Medicine, poor sleep increases inflammation and disrupts metabolic regulation: https://www.health.harvard.edu/staying-healthy/the-hidden-dangers-of-chronic-inflammation
To support healthier ceramide levels:
- keep a consistent sleep schedule
- limit screens 1 hour before bed
- dim lights in the evening
- avoid heavy meals late at night
- consider a calming wind-down routine
Even modest improvements can significantly influence metabolic balance.
Reduce Stress Through Daily Regulation Techniques
Chronic stress raises inflammation markers, which may contribute to ceramide accumulation.
Simple daily practices can make a meaningful difference:
- 5-minute deep-breathing sessions
- stepping outside for sunlight
- short walking breaks
- brief stretching or mobility exercises
- pausing for slow inhales/exhales between tasks
These micro-regulations help stabilize the nervous system, lowering metabolic strain.
Increase Daily Movement (Low-Intensity Counts)
You don’t need strenuous workouts to support metabolism — low-intensity, consistent movement is highly effective:
- walking
- light cycling
- casual yoga
- relaxed swimming
- any activity sustained at a gentle pace
Movement helps your body use fat as energy and lowers inflammation, both of which support ceramide balance.

Nutrition Patterns That May Help Reduce Ceramides
Food choices influence ceramides because they regulate inflammation and lipid metabolism.
Increase Fiber and Whole Plant Foods
Fiber supports:
- gut health
- blood sugar regulation
- reduced inflammation
- smoother appetite signals
Good options include vegetables, legumes, oats, fruits, and whole grains.
Favor Anti-Inflammatory Choices
The Cleveland Clinic notes that persistent inflammation is linked with abdominal fat and metabolic dysfunction.
Supportive choices include:
- leafy greens
- berries
- olive oil
- nuts and seeds
- herbs and spices (ginger, turmeric, rosemary)
Reduce Processed Sugars and Refined Oils
These foods promote inflammatory responses that may elevate ceramides.
Prioritize:
- home-cooked meals
- simple ingredients
- balanced macronutrients
Prioritize Balanced Meals (Protein + Fiber + Healthy Fats)
Balanced meals help stabilize glucose and insulin responses, lowering inflammatory signals that contribute to ceramide buildup.
